Sonnet for Daisy Haggard

I've seen her many times in TV shows
and films and never made a passing thought
of how she was the spit of girls I chose
as my ideal when as I teen I wrought
to conquer my inadequate visage
and come to terms with being gay as rain.
I must have always looked outré, bizarre
with heavy-lidded eyes and face like train
but mellowed in my later years, a switch
clicks in my goin. Could this be love once more?
a crush upon an actress to bewitch
me as a grey old lady and a bore
who rarely leaves the house except for walks
with dog and of immoral youth still talks.
